Motor and Power System
The motor and power system are the heart of the device. They provide the necessary energy to operate the blender. Identifying the motor’s condition is crucial, especially if the machine isn’t turning on or making unusual noises. Regular checks of the wiring and connections can prevent potential failures.
Blades and Container Assembly
The blades and container assembly are key to the blending process. If the appliance isn’t performing as expected, the issue could lie in dull or damaged blades. Inspecting the container for cracks or wear and tear is also essential to avoid leaks and ensure optimal performance during use.

Blade Assembly and Container
The blade assembly and container are frequently subjected to wear and tear. The blades can become dull or damaged after extensive use, affecting the efficiency of the blending process. Similarly, the container may develop cracks or leaks, requiring replacement to prevent spills and ensure safe operation.
Motor and Electrical Components
If the appliance experiences power issues or unusual noises, the motor and related electrical components should be checked. These are among the most common areas requiring attention, especially if the blender fails to start or stop functioning properly. Regular inspection of the motor’s wiring and connections can help prevent further damage and costly repairs.
